So far Sega hasn't put any of their arcade games on a plug-and-play, except for those that were ported to the Genesis. That's too bad really, because an all-in-one with games like Zaxxon, Congo Bongo, Turbo and the lesser-known Gremlin collaborations would fit right in with the Atari, Namco and Konami sticks that continue to make the rounds. Pitfall II would be a little more complicated, partly due to the licensing and partly due to not many arcade plug-and-plays focusing on any era after the early '80s.

 

The SG-1000 cartridge is probably a little hard to find, especially if you live outside of Japan. Perhaps slightly easier to find is the ColecoVision port that Pixelboy released.
